The following is a method of making a shock-absorbing drop resistance camera: 1. ** External protection structure ** - A protective cover made of silica gel was used to wrap the camera. The silica gel material had good shock absorption. When the camera fell to the ground, it could play a preliminary shock absorption role. - A buffer block is fixedly embedded around the protective cover, a buffer strip is embedded inside the buffer block, an isolation block is fixedly connected inside the buffer strip, and a high-elasticity elastic ball is filled in the gap between the isolation block and the buffer strip. These parts were all made of rubber. When the camera fell, the high-elastic rubber buffer block provided a second buffer, and then the elastic ball inside the buffer strip squeezed to achieve a third buffer, thus achieving a good shock absorption and anti-fall effect. 2. ** In terms of preventing hands from slipping and lens protection ** - A bracelet was installed on one side of the camera. The bracelet could be connected to the hand to prevent the camera from falling from the hand. - The outer side of the protective cover is connected to the lens cover through an elastic rope. One end of the elastic rope is fixedly connected to the protective cover, and the other end is connected to the lens cover in an interference manner. Moreover, cleaning cotton was embedded inside the lens cover to prevent the lens from being damaged when the camera was dropped, and to prevent dust from falling when the lens was stored. 3. ** Other parts settings ** - For example, the front end of the camera was fixedly connected to the camera, and the camera was opened inside the camera. The front end was connected to the bottom of the speaker, and the left side of the camera was connected to the camera screen. The setting of the basic components had to meet the functional requirements of the camera. At the same time, these components could be better protected under the overall drop resistance structure. The method of making a bamboo fence was as follows: First, find a few fresh bamboos, cut them down, and remove the scabs and tips. Then, he used a saw to cut the bamboo into the required height of the fence, and each section was cut open with a knife. Next, he made bamboo strips, cut the bamboo into a width of about 10 mm, and removed the yellow bamboo strips. He laid the bamboo pieces that he had just cut open on the ground and used the bamboo strips that he had made to connect the bamboo pieces according to the interweaving method. After the production was completed, he could choose to plant some flowers or trees to increase the aesthetics of the courtyard.

The manufacturing method of the foldable bamboo fence could use steel nails, linen, or bamboo strips to fix the vertical poles. The specific steps were as follows: First, use a machete to cut the bamboo into bamboo boards that were 1 meter long and 3 centimeters wide. Then, according to the required length, the bamboo board was fixed to the wooden or bamboo pole with a fine hemp rope or plastic rope. Finally, he used a hammer and nails to fix the fence to the ground, completing the production of the foldable bamboo fence.

The manufacturing method of the foldable bamboo fence. First, he needed to prepare bamboo and use a machete to cut the bamboo into bamboo boards that were 1 meter long and 3 centimeters wide. Then, he used a saw to cut the bamboo board into the required height of the fence, and each section was cut open with a knife. Next, he began to weave a bamboo fence with linen rope from the middle, folded it in half from the middle and fixed it on the first bamboo board, then woven it one by one. When 15-16 bamboo fences were woven, they could be folded back and repeated for a second time, 4-6 times back and forth to make the bamboo fence stronger. Finally, repeat the steps above to make more sections of the bamboo fence as needed. In this way, a simple bamboo fence could be made.

You can also create a 3D globe with a pseudo-metallic texture through the form and CCSphere plug-ins in the software. By adjusting the lighting and material parameters of different layers of CCSphere, you can simulate a high-light and reflective metallic texture after stacking them. By adjusting the content of the layer added with CCSphere, you can switch the content of the sphere map at will. The CCSphere plug-in can also perform a real 3D rotation operation on the sphere.
